Snorkelling stops include:
• South Channel – Explore clear waters and healthy reef systems, home to a variety of tropical marine life.
• Shark Ray Alley – See nurse sharks and southern stingrays in their natural environment.
• Coral Gardens – Discover colourful coral formations surrounded by tropical fish.
Sightseeing stop:
• Tarpon Cove – Observe large tarpons in their natural habitat and, when present, spot iguanas along the mangroves.
